Malegaon:
The Superman of Malegaon, the documentary film which introduced
Mollywood - the local film industry to the International
audience as never before, has been included for screening
in Berlin on December 04, 2011.
"The complete 70 min screening of
the documentary film has been included as part of the 4-day special program
on film piracy titled 'Postcolonial Piracy-Media Distribution and Cultural
Production in the Global South'", Shaikh Nasir, Director of
Malegaon Ka Superman, said to ummid.com before leaving for Germany November
30.
"Superman of Malegaon will be
screened at Haus der Kulturen der Welt in Berlin on December 04 at
01:00 PM local time", he added.
Shaik Nasir is accompanied by Faiza
Ahmed Khan, director of The Superman of Malegaon, and Ranjani
Mazumdar on this international tour.
While Ranjani Mazumdar has been
scheduled to introduce the documentary to the German audience, the
screening of the film will be followed by a discussion with Shaikh
Nasir and Faiza A Khan on 'Making of Malegaon ka Superman'.

Mollywood has been busy
making re-makes of the popular Bollywood numbers since last
more than two decades. Its film 'Malegaon Ka Superman' hit
the international headlines when Faiza Khan made a documentary
film on 'Making of Malegaon Ka Superman' simultaneously and
received the
Jury Award for Best Documentary at Asiatica
Film Mediale, Rome in 2008.
The film was
later selected for screening - first by Ocian’s Cinefan film
festival held in New Delhi, and later for the International Film
Festival of India (IFFI) which was held in Goa in November 2009.
In the same year, the film was also selected for the film
festivals held in United States, Pakistan, Romania, Poland,
Israel, Spain and China in quick successions. In January 2010, the
film was screened in Dhaka and Kuwait, and in February 2010 was
selected for Vesoul Asian FF, France.
A tragic moment
in the long and delightful journey of the film came when
Shafeeque Ahmed, the local hero who played the lead-role in
Malegaon Ka Superman died on September 07, 2011.
Shafeeques had earned laurels from
international film critics and experts when in his film he
campaigned against tobacco use and warned people about its danger.
But two years after completion of the film, he himself became victim
of the same menace. He was just 26 when died of cancer.
